ST. MARGARET'S OLD GIRLS' DRAMA CIRCLE.

Tho St. Margaret's Old Girls' Drama Ouclo is presenting two plays at the JotUcoe Hall on Thursday evening, under the direction of Miss Nela Billcliff. "The Knave of Hearts," by Louisci Saiimlcrs isa marionette play, dealinr; with the wellknown rascal who stole the famous tarls The other play, "Ticklcss Time " is a comedy by Susan Oiaspell.
